Manchester United are planning summer moves for both Mohammed Kudus and Matheus Cunha.

The Red Devils are looking at major changes to their squad, despite winning the FA Cup final against Manchester City.

Along with making a number of their players available for transfer, United are looking to bring in more quality to bolster their squad. Wolves striker Matheus Cunha and West Ham midfielder Mohammed Kudus seem to be topping their list.

Cunha could cost as much as £60 million, given his value to Wolverhampton Wanderers since signing from Atletico Madrid. This price tag has yet to deter United, who have been tracking the player for a long time.

United could double Cunha’s ‘modest’ £60,000 a week wages, in order to lure the Brazilian away from the Molineux Stadium.

Kudus is a player very familiar to head coach Erik Ten Hag, who managed the Ghanaian during his spell at Dutch giants Ajax. Kudus has impressed in his first season at West Ham United, operating both as a central midfielder and a right winger.

According to The Express, United could face competition from Liverpool for Kudus’ signature. Liverpool are keen to sign Kudus should Mohamed Salah leave Anfield this summer.
